The AFL has finally locked in all games after an OK from the South Australian government to travel

Collingwood will in and fly out of Adelaide for Saturdays clash with the Crows after state government approval helped the AFL finalise the Round 12 Covid-affected jigsaw. The match has been approved by the SA Government on the basis of a set of agreed protocols to be adopted by both clubs.
It was the final match to be locked in for a revamped round, with all matches moved intestate.
